PostgreSQL 图形化管理工具比较

John Doe 十二月 3, 2025

本次对比覆盖官方专属、通用开源、轻量小众、商业易用、企业级 IDE 五类典型工具,从功能深度、易用性、成本、性能等核心维度拆解,帮你精准匹配运维/开发/轻量管理/企业协作等不同场景。

image

核心选型维度

维度 关键考量点
PG 功能适配 对 PG 专属功能(分区表、WAL、备份恢复、查询计划、扩展插件)的支持深度
易用性 界面逻辑、学习成本、日常操作效率(建表/写 SQL /数据同步)
性能 启动速度、内存占用、大数据集/复杂查询的流畅度
多库兼容性 是否支持 MySQL/Oracle/ClickHouse 等其他数据库(多库管理场景核心指标)
成本 免费/付费、授权方式(永久/按年)、团队版成本(企业场景重点)
部署/适配 支持平台(桌面 / Web)、云数据库、SSH 隧道等适配能力

五款工具核心拆解

pgAdmin(PostgreSQL 官方标配)

核心定位:PostgreSQL专属、全功能运维管理工具(无商业化版本,100% 开源)。

成本:完全免费(开源协议:PostgreSQL License)。

支持平台:Windows/macOS/Linux(桌面版 + Web 版,Web 版可部署在服务器远程管理)。

核心优势

  • PG功能全覆盖:唯一完美适配 PG 所有原生功能的工具,支持 WAL 日志监控、分区表精细化管理、角色/权限粒度控制、可视化执行计划分析、一键备份/恢复/迁移,甚至兼容 PostGIS 等 PG 扩展插件;
  • 运维友好:内置服务器状态监控、会话管理、慢查询分析,支持批量 DDL 操作,适配 PG 最新版本(如 PG 18);
  • 无商业化限制:无功能阉割,可放心用于企业生产环境。

核心短板

  • 界面层级复杂,新手学习曲线陡峭(需 1-2 周熟悉功能布局);
  • 仅支持 PostgreSQL 系数据库(不支持 MySQL/Oracle 等);
  • 部分操作(如批量改表结构)步骤繁琐,缺乏可视化拖拽。

适用人群:PostgreSQL 专职 DBA、运维人员、需要精细化管理 PG 的技术团队、仅使用 PG 单数据库的场景。

DBeaver(通用开源首选)

核心定位:多数据库一站式管理工具(社区版免费,企业版侧重团队协作)。

成本

  • 社区版:完全免费(开源协议:Apache 2.0);
  • 企业版:≈¥1000/人/年(增值功能:团队协作、高级调试、专属技术支持)。

支持平台:Windows/macOS/Linux(仅桌面版,无 Web 版)。

核心优势

  • 多库兼容天花板:支持40+数据库(PG/MySQL/Oracle/ClickHouse/SQLite 等),一站式管理所有数据库,无需切换工具;
  • SQL编辑体验优秀:语法智能补全、格式化、调试、查询结果可视化(图表/ER图),支持自定义插件扩展;
  • 云数据库适配完善:无缝对接公有云 RDS PG 等,内置SSH隧道/SSL连接。

核心短板

  • Java 架构导致启动慢(首次启动≈10秒)、内存占用高(≥500MB),大数据集操作易卡顿;
  • PG 高级运维功能(如 WAL 监控、精细化权限)略弱于 pgAdmin;
  • 部分高级功能(如执行计划优化)需手动配置,不如 pgAdmin 直观。

适用人群:同时管理多类型数据库的开发者、中小团队、预算有限的企业、需要 SQL 可视化/数据迁移的场景。

PgManage(轻量小众 Web 工具)

核心定位:轻量级 Web 版 PostgreSQL 管理工具(开源小众,专注基础管理)。

成本:完全免费(开源协议:MIT)。

支持平台:跨平台(仅 Web 版,需部署在服务器,通过浏览器访问)。

核心优势

  • 极致轻量:部署包仅几 MB,依赖少(基于 Python/Flask),低配服务器也能运行;
  • 界面简洁:仅保留 PG 基础管理功能(建表/查数据/简单 SQL 编辑),新手 5 分钟上手;
  • 远程管理便捷:Web 版无需安装桌面客户端,适合无桌面环境的服务器/云主机管理。

核心短板

  • 功能极度精简:无备份/恢复、执行计划分析、WAL 监控、分区表管理等核心运维功能;
  • 维护活跃度低:社区小,更新频率低,适配 PG 新版本(如 PG 18)可能滞后;
  • 无可视化 SQL 调试、数据迁移等开发功能。

适用人群:轻量管理 PG 的个人开发者、小型项目临时远程访问 PG、对功能要求极低的场景(仅基础 CRUD)。

核心定位:易用型商业数据库管理工具(侧重可视化操作,降低学习成本)。

成本

  • 标准版:≈¥1500(永久授权);
  • 企业版:≈¥3000/年(含团队协作、云数据库高级适配)。

支持平台:Windows/macOS/Linux(仅桌面版)。

核心优势

  • 零学习成本:界面逻辑贴合普通用户习惯,建表/改数据/数据同步可通过拖拽一键完成;
  • 数据迁移/同步高效:支持不同数据库间(如 PG→MySQL)的结构/数据同步,稳定性优于开源工具;
  • 体验优化到位:内置数据对比、备份计划、暗黑模式,操作流畅度远超开源工具。

核心短板

  • PG 高级功能支持不足:无 WAL 监控、精细化权限控制,查询计划分析功能简陋;
  • 授权成本高:团队版按人数收费,中小企业成本压力大;
  • 仅支持主流数据库,小众数据库(如 ClickHouse)适配差。

适用人群:追求易用性的开发者、企业日常开发、非专职 PG 运维人员、需要快速完成数据同步/迁移的场景。

DataGrip(JetBrains 企业级 IDE)

核心定位:智能数据库开发 IDE(侧重企业级开发、团队协作)。

成本

  • 个人版:≈¥1400/年;
  • 企业版:≈¥3000/人/年(学生/开源项目可免费申请)。

支持平台:Windows/macOS/Linux(仅桌面版)。

核心优势

  • SQL智能感知天花板:支持语法提示、代码重构、错误实时检测,远超其他工具;
  • 开发工具链集成:与 IntelliJ IDEA、PyCharm 等 JetBrains 产品无缝联动,开发调试一体化;
  • 高级功能完善:内置查询优化、版本控制、团队协作、数据库重构,适配企业级开发流程。

核心短板

  • 价格昂贵:个人版年费高,中小企业团队部署成本高;
  • 学习成本高:功能复杂,需1-2周熟悉高级功能;
  • 启动速度慢(≈8秒),内存占用高(≥800MB),轻量使用性价比低。

适用人群:企业级 Java/Python 开发者、使用 JetBrains 生态的团队、需要高级 SQL 调试/团队协作的场景。

五款工具功能对比表

功能/工具 pgAdmin DBeaver 社区版 PgManage Navicat DataGrip
PG全功能支持 ★★★★★ ★★★★☆ ★★☆☆☆ ★★★★☆ ★★★★★
多数据库兼容 ★★☆☆☆ ★★★★★ ★★☆☆☆ ★★★★☆ ★★★★★
启动速度 ★★★☆☆ ★★☆☆☆ ★★★★★ ★★★★☆ ★★★☆☆
内存占用 ★★★★☆ ★★☆☆☆ ★★★★★ ★★★★☆ ★★☆☆☆
备份/恢复 ★★★★★ ★★★★☆ ★☆☆☆☆ ★★★★☆ ★★★★☆
SQL智能感知 ★★★☆☆ ★★★★☆ ★★☆☆☆ ★★★★☆ ★★★★★
执行计划分析 ★★★★★ ★★★☆☆ ★☆☆☆☆ ★★★☆☆ ★★★★★
云数据库适配 ★★★★☆ ★★★★★ ★★☆☆☆ ★★★★★ ★★★★★
新手友好度 ★★☆☆☆ ★★★☆☆ ★★★★☆ ★★★★★ ★★★☆☆
成本 免费 免费/付费 免费 付费 付费

使用场景推荐

场景 1:PostgreSQL 专职运维/管理

首选:pgAdmin 理由:官方工具,PG 功能全覆盖,备份、权限、监控等运维功能无短板,免费且无商业化限制。

场景 2:同时管理 PG+MySQL/Oracle 等多数据库

首选:DBeaver 社区版(免费)/ DataGrip(付费) 理由:DBeaver 免费且多库兼容最全;DataGrip 智能感知更强,适配开发工具链。

场景 3:新手入门/快速查数据/轻量远程管理

首选:PgManage(Web 轻量)/ Beekeeper Studio(补充,免费桌面) 理由:PgManage 部署简单,无桌面客户端;若需桌面版,可搭配免费的 Beekeeper Studio。

场景 4:追求易用性,不想折腾(企业/个人付费)

首选:Navicat 理由:界面零学习成本,数据同步/迁移一键完成,适合非专职 PG 运维人员。

场景 5:企业级开发/团队协作/高级 SQL 调试

首选:DataGrip 理由:智能感知、开发工具链集成、团队协作功能完善,适配企业级开发流程。

场景 6:低配服务器远程管理 PG(无桌面环境)

首选:pgAdmin Web 版 / PgManage 理由:pgAdmin Web 版功能全,PgManage 更轻量,按需选择。

总结建议

1. 免费场景优先级:pgAdmin(PG 专属运维)> DBeaver 社区版(多库开发)> PgManage(轻量 Web);

2. 付费场景优先级:Navicat(易用性)> DataGrip(企业级开发);

3. 避坑提示

  • PgManage 仅适合极轻量场景,切勿用于生产环境运维;
  • DataGrip 价格高,轻量使用(仅写 SQL)性价比低;
  • Navicat 虽易用,但 PG 高级运维功能需搭配 pgAdmin 使用;

4. 组合使用:可同时安装 pgAdmin(运维)+ DBeaver(开发)+ Beekeeper Studio(轻量查询),按场景切换,兼顾功能与效率。